Heterogeneous Video Transcoder for H.264/AVC to HEVC: Review

چکیده

As a successor to the H.264/Advance Video Coding (AVC), High Efficiency Video Coding (HEVC) is invented to get more compression and high quality video. But HEVC increases the complexity of video coding. To reduce this complexity various methods are proposed with different approach which also enhance the video compression and quality of video. This paper contains different techniques for video transcoding such as dynamic thresholding, mode mapping, machine learning, complexity scalable and background modeling. Comparison of all techniques gives their advantages and disadvantages to modify video transcoder which benefits from the strength points of existing methods.
